LFO
---
:author: Paul Nasca

Introduzione
~~~~~~~~~~~~

"LFO" significa Low Frequency Oscillator. Questi oscillatori non sono usati per
fare suoni da soli, ma per cambiare alcuni parametri (come le frequenze, le
ampiezze o i filtri).

L'LFO ha alcuni parametri di base:

* *Delay*: Questo parametro imposta il tempo tra l'inizio della nota e l'inizio
           dell'LFO
* *Start Phase*: La posizione che avrà l'LFO alla partenza
* *Frequency*: La velocità dell'LFO (quanto velocemente il parametro è controllato
               dai cambiamenti dell'LFO)
* *Depth*: L'ampiezza dell'LFO (quanto il parametro è controllato dai cambiamenti
           dell'LFO)

image:images/lfo0.png[]

Un altro importante parametro dell'LFO è la forma '(shape)'. Ci sono molti
tipi di LFO in base alla forma. ZynAddSubFX supporta le seguenti forme:

image:images/lfo1.png[]

Un altro parametro è 'LFO Randomness' (casualità dell'LFO). 
Esso modifica casualmente l'ampiezza o la frequenza dell'LFO ed in ZynAddSubFX puoi scegliere quanto, con questo parametro. 
Nelle seguenti immagini sono mostrati alcuni esempi di casualità e come cambia la
forma d'onda triangolare dell'LFO.

image:images/lfo2.png[]

Altri parametri sono:

* *Continous mode*: Se si utilizza questa modalità, l'LFO non partirà da "zero"
ad ogni nuova nota, ma sarà continuo. E' molto utile applicato sui filtri, per
fare interessanti 'sweeps'.
* *Stretch*: Controlla quanto la frequenza dell'LFO cambia in base alla frequenza
della nota.
Si può passare da 'stretch' negativo (la frequenza dell'LFO diminuisce sulle
note più alte) a zero (rimane la stessa in tutte le note) a 'stretch' positivo
(aumenta sulle note più alte).

User Interface
~~~~~~~~~~~~~~

In ZynAddSubFX i parametri dell'LFO sono mostrati così:

image:images/uilfo.jpg[]

Questi parametri sono:

* *Freq*: LFO Frequency
* *Depth*: LFO Depth
* *Start*: LFO Start Phase - 
Se questo knob è al valore più basso, LFO Start Phase sarà random
* *Delay*: LFO Delay
* *A.R.*: LFO Amplitude Randomnes
* *F.R.*: LFO Frequency Randomness
* *C.*: LFO Continous Mode
* *Str.*: LFO Stretch - Nell'immagine sopra LFO Stretch è impostato a zero
